AbelCine is a leading Digital Cinema and HD technology company servicing the filmmaking, broadcast and new media industries. We offer sales, rental, technical services and financing to the professional production community with offices in NY, CHI and LA. Our NYC headquarters is currently seeking a Camera Equipment Repair Technician to join our Tech Services team.

The focus of this position is to provide repair, maintenance, cleaning and quality assurance of professional cinema and broadcast cameras and accessories as well as on-site installation and technical support.  This is an excellent opportunity for a dynamic, hardworking individual to participate in our exciting and fast-paced company. 

This key position encompasses the following responsibilities: 

  • Digital camera repair and maintenance 
  • Monitor repair and calibration 
  • Camera system and accessory repair 
  • Custom cable assembly 
  • Mechanical repair of tripods, matte boxes, follow focus, and other accessories. 
  • Provide onsite tech support for installations and studio builds  
  • Client phone and on-site technical support 
  • Provide technical support for Rental and Sales Departments   

Successful applicants should possess the following attributes: 

  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ent technical, hands-on industry experience 
  • 1+ years of experience performing mechanical troubleshooting and repair 
  • Skills and proficiency with soldering 
  • Experience with electronic repair, mechanical repair and assembly 
  • Experience with Sony, ARRI, Canon and RED digital cinema cameras 
  • Experience with digital cinema production, fiber systems, formats, and post-production workflows 
  • Proficiency in reading mechanical and electronic schematics 
  • IT skills and experience with Mac OS and Windows platforms 
  • Experience performing monitor calibrations and familiarity with industry standards is a plus  
  • Exceptional communication skills, including professional written and verbal communication 
  • Ability to work autonomously, as well as with clients and coworkers to hit deadlines

Why are you being asked to complete this form?

We are a federal contractor or subcontractor. The law requires us to provide equal employment opportunity to qualified people with disabilities. We have a goal of having at least 7% of our workers as people with disabilities. The law says we must measure our progress towards this goal. To do this, we must ask applicants and employees if they have a disability or have ever had one. People can become disabled, so we need to ask this question at least every five years.

Completing this form is voluntary, and we hope that you will choose to do so. Your answer is confidential. No one who makes hiring decisions will see it. Your decision to complete the form and your answer will not harm you in any way. If you want to learn more about the law or this form, visit the U.S. Department of Labor’s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(OFCCP) website at www.dol.gov/ofccp.

How do you know if you have a disability?

A disability is a condition that substantially limits one or more of your “major life activities.” If you have or have ever had such a condition, you are a person with a disability. Disabilities include, but are not limited to:

  • Alcohol or other substance use disorder (not currently using drugs illegally)
  • Autoimmune disorder, for example, lupus, fibromyalgia, rheumatoid arthritis, HIV/AIDS
  • Blind or low vision
  • Cancer (past or present)
  • Cardiovascular or heart disease
  • Celiac disease
  • Cerebral palsy
  • Deaf or serious difficulty hearing
  • Diabetes
  • Disfigurement, for example, disfigurement caused by burns, wounds, accidents, or congenital disorders
  • Epilepsy or other seizure disorder
  • Gastrointestinal disorders, for example, Crohn's Disease, irritable bowel syndrome
  • Intellectual or developmental disability
  • Mental health conditions, for example, depression, bipolar disorder, anxiety disorder, schizophrenia, PTSD
  • Missing limbs or partially missing limbs
  • Mobility impairment, benefiting from the use of a wheelchair, scooter, walker, leg brace(s) and/or other supports
  • Nervous system condition, for example, migraine headaches,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is (MS)
  • Neurodivergence, for example, att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), autism spectrum disorder, dyslexia, dyspraxia, other learning disabilities
  • Partial or complete paralysis (any cause)
  • Pulmonary or respiratory conditions, for example, tuberculosis, asthma, emphysema
  • Short stature (dwarfism)
  • Traumatic brain injury
